Disclosed ingredients in the order they appear on the label, with our independent assessment where we hold reference data.
Washing soda. Strongly alkaline and dusty in powder form.
The carrier for most liquid cleaners. No exposure risk on its own.
A gentle water softener and pH buffer derived from citric acid.
Baking soda. Mildly abrasive and odour-absorbing, low toxicity.
A plant-derived humectant that softens and holds moisture.
Plant fibre used to bind and thicken. Inert and biodegradable.
A synthetic film and anti-redeposition polymer. Low acute risk, does not biodegrade.
A food-grade preservative with low toxicity.
A soap-like salt used in dishwasher tablets. Alkaline in concentrate, mild once diluted.
A common non-ionic detergent surfactant. Irritating in concentrate, mild at use dilution; rinse floors before paws.
Sodium Carbonate, Water, Sodium Citrate, Sodium Bicarbonate, Glycerin, Cellulose, Acrylate / Styrene Copolymer, Sodium Benzoate, Potassium Isononanoate, Ethoxylated Propoxylated Alcohols, Isononanoic Acid, Potassium Hydroxide
